For these so-named collision attacks to work, an attacker must be in a position to control two individual inputs while in the hope of finally getting two different combos which have a matching hash.
This prevalent adoption implies that MD5 remains an ordinary choice for several existing devices and programs, ensuring relieve of integration.
This informs you which the file is corrupted. This is often only helpful when the info has actually been unintentionally corrupted, on the other hand, rather than in the case of malicious tampering.
The reasons why MD5 hashes are generally prepared in hexadecimal go beyond the scope on the report, but at the least now you know that the letters genuinely just symbolize a special counting method.
In 1993, Den Boer and Bosselaers gave an early, Even though limited, results of finding a "pseudo-collision" of your MD5 compression operate; that's, two unique initialization vectors that make The same digest.
Consider you've just penned by far the most gorgeous letter to your Mate overseas, but you wish to make certain it would not get tampered with for the duration of its journey. You decide to seal the envelope, but in place of utilizing just any outdated sticker, you use a singular, uncopyable seal.
Allow’s contemplate each of the apps you utilize each day, from purchasing foods to streaming your favorite show—none of This is able to be doable devoid of application engineers.
Because technology is not likely everywhere and does more fantastic than damage, adapting is the greatest study course of action. That is wherever The Tech Edvocate comes in. We want to protect the PreK-12 and better Training EdTech sectors and supply our visitors with the most up-to-date news and opinion on the topic.
Inspite of its previous recognition, the MD5 hashing algorithm is now not deemed secure on account of its vulnerability to various collision assaults. Because of this, it is usually recommended to work with more secure cryptographic hash features like SHA-256 or SHA-three.
Just bear in mind, on earth of cybersecurity, remaining up to date and adapting to new techniques will be the name of the sport. It can be form of like trend - you wouldn't want to be caught sporting bell-bottoms in 2022, would you?
Very first off, MD5 is rapid and economical. It's just like the hare inside the race in opposition to the tortoise—it will get The work finished immediately. This speed is actually a essential component if you're processing significant quantities of data.
Even with breaches like All those explained above, MD5 can nonetheless be utilized for normal file verifications and to be a checksum to verify information integrity, but get more info only in opposition to unintentional corruption.
Before diving into MD5 precisely, let us briefly touch upon the concept of hashing generally speaking. In very simple phrases, hashing is actually a procedure that usually takes an enter (often known as the concept or info) and creates a fixed-sizing string of people as output, that's known as the hash code or hash benefit.
Even with its Original intention, MD5 is considered to be broken because of its vulnerability to varied attack vectors. Collisions, the place two unique inputs deliver a similar hash value, can be generated with relative ease utilizing modern day computational electrical power. As a result, MD5 is not advisable for cryptographic needs, for example password storage.